The difference between Henderson and dier pens is simple.

Keeper went all out to save Henderson where as with dier he didn't go straight away in case dier went down the middle.

Hence why he got slight hand but moved too late without the conviction he did for henderson.

To put It simply, keeper was covering two basis with dier.....gone all out like he did for Henderson he saves it
